※ 引述《jlovet.bbs@ptt.cc (Want 2 see u no more)》之銘言:
先謝謝你的回應 ^^
> 你有相依的DLL沒有複製過去
> http://www.dependencywalker.com/
> 用這個看看他需要什麼DLL
> 從系統工具,訊息裡面會看到SxS Assembly 錯誤
> 或是
> 你可以用VS直接打開那個exe檔
> 看resource裡面有一個 RT_MANIFEST
我用VS打開exe檔以後找不到resource耶
可以再請問他的路徑在哪裡嗎??
感激!!
> 裡面就會寫他相依的 assembly
> <assemblyIdentity type="win32" name="Microsoft.VC90.DebugCRT"
> version="9.0.21022.8" processorArchitecture="x86"
> publicKeyToken="1fc8b3b9a1e18e3b"></assemblyIdentity>
> 假如是 x86_Microsoft.VC90.DebugCRT_1fc8b3b9a1e18e3b_9.0.21022.8_x-ww_597c3456
> 這個好了
> 那就去 Windows\WinSxS 裡面
> 複製該版本的dll檔
> 還有Windows\WinSxS\manifests 裡面相對應的manifest也複製過去
> 改名成
> Microsoft.VC90.DebugCRT.manifest 就是上面assembly的名字
> 就好了!
--
▄▄▄▄▄▄▄ ▄▄▄▄ ▄▄▄▄▄▄ <telnet://bbs.cs.nctu.edu.tw>
█▄▄▄▄█ █ ▄▄▄▄▄█ Player: kuoelec
▄█▄▄▄▄█ ▄▄▄█ █▄▄▄▄▄ From: 118-160-104-95.dynamic.hine
☆ 次世代BS2 ☆ 可申請個人板 150MB 相簿 http://pic.bs2.to 交大資訊人 250MB